From the supplier: The privatization of infrastructure in East Asian countries has progressed slowly because of government reluctance to relinquish control. Private investment in infrastructure in the region, excluding Japan, accounts for only between 12% to 18% of total investment, compared to 50% in Chile and at least 70% in Argentina and Hungary. Attempts to privatize infrastructure have been hindered by governments that are reluctant to relinquish control. East Asian governments need to liberalize the infrastructure sector and promote competition, while creating new strategic roles for themselves. They must disengage from direct or contingent financing of projects, and create a transparent regulatory environment that reaffirms the government's commitment to privatization.
